3-hydroxyaspartate aldolase

In enzymology, a 3-hydroxyaspartate aldolase (EC 4.1.3.14) is an enzyme that catalyzes the chemical reaction

erythro-3-hydroxy-Ls-aspartate glycine + glyoxylate

Hence, this enzyme has one substrate, erythro-3-hydroxy-Ls-aspartate, and two products, glycine and glyoxylate.

This enzyme belongs to the family of lyases, specifically the oxo-acid-lyases, which cleave carbon-carbon bonds. The systematic name of this enzyme class is erythro-3-hydroxy-Ls-aspartate glyoxylate-lyase (glycine-forming). Other names in common use include erythro-beta-hydroxyaspartate aldolase, erythro-beta-hydroxyaspartate glycine-lyase, and erythro-3-hydroxy-Ls-aspartate glyoxylate-lyase.
